Jewish Museum Lisbon – Association Hagada

The Lisbon Jewish Museum will tell the story of a millennium of Jewish presence in the territory that is today Portugal, namely in Lisbon, stressing the Jewish contribution towards the history of the Portuguese nation. The historical itinerary of the Museum will cover 5 key periods:

  • The age of the “Convivência” also known as “The Time of the Jews”, from the XII to the XV centuries;
  • The Jews under Roman, Visigoth and Islamic domain;
  • The Age of Intolerance: Expulsion, forced Conversion, Inquisition;
  • The Portuguese-Jewish Diaspora, between the XVI and XVIII centuries;
  • The contemporary Revival of Judaism in the XIX-XX centuries.
